Zamfara Chief of Staff Survives Gunmen Attack

The Chief of Staff to the Zamfara State Government House, Moukhtar Lugga, narrowly escaped death on Thursday evening after gunmen opened fire on his vehicle along the Funtua–Gusau road. Gov. Lawal Makes Promises to Communities Affected by Bandits Attack

Zamfara State Governor Dauda Lawal has pledged to provide basic amenities, including roads, electricity, potable water, and mobile network services, to communities ravaged by bandit attacks in Kaura Namoda Local Government Area.
